+ ## 1. Ignition
24
+
25
+ ### What VoidForge Is
26
+
27
+ VoidForge is a **methodology framework** for building full-stack applications with Claude Code. It's not a code template — it's a *process* template. Drop in a Product Requirements Document, and a named team of AI agents across 9 fictional universes builds your application through a 13-phase protocol.
28
+
29
+ **From nothing, everything.**
30
+
31
+ It works with any tech stack: Next.js, Express, Django, Rails, Go, or whatever your PRD specifies. VoidForge doesn't care about frameworks — it cares about *process*.

+
137
+ **Credentials flow:** Gandalf stores all credentials (API keys, cloud tokens, project-specific env vars) in the encrypted vault at `~/.voidforge/vault.enc`. These are available to the deploy wizard (Haku) and provisioners. During `/build`, Claude Code reads project-specific env vars from `docs/PRD.md` frontmatter and the `.env` file. If your PRD references APIs (WhatsApp, Stripe, Resend, etc.) and you provided keys in Gandalf's Step 4b, they're in the vault — the build and deploy phases will inject them into `.env` when provisioning. For local development before deploy, add them to `.env` manually or run the deploy wizard with just the env-writing step.
138
+
139
+ **Vault key naming:** The vault uses two key formats. **Hyphenated keys** are for global/infrastructure credentials stored by the wizard: `anthropic-api-key`, `aws-access-key-id`, `aws-secret-access-key`, `vercel-token`, `railway-token`, `cloudflare-api-token`, `cloudflare-zone-id`. **`env:`-prefixed keys** are for project-specific environment variables: `env:WHATSAPP_ACCESS_TOKEN`, `env:STRIPE_SECRET_KEY`, `env:DATABASE_URL`. When resolving a vault key, check the `env:` prefix first (exact match), then fall back to the hyphenated format. The provisioners map hyphenated keys to their `.env` equivalents during deployment (e.g., `anthropic-api-key` → `ANTHROPIC_API_KEY`).

+ ## 3. The Protocol
207
+
208
+ ### The 13 Phases
209
+
210
+ The build protocol is a sequence of phases, each led by a specialist agent. Phases have verification gates — you can't advance until the gate passes. Some phases can be skipped based on your PRD frontmatter.
211
+
212
+ | Phase | Lead | What Happens |
213
+ |-------|------|-------------|
214
+ | **0. Orient** | Picard | Reads PRD, validates frontmatter, produces ADRs, flags gaps |
215
+ | **1. Scaffold** | Stark + Kusanagi | Framework init, directory structure, test runner setup |
216
+ | **2. Infrastructure** | Kusanagi | Database, Redis, environment config, verify boot |
217
+ | **3. Auth** | Stark + Galadriel | Login, signup, OAuth, sessions, roles. Kenobi reviews. |
218
+ | **4. Core Feature** | Stark + Galadriel | Most important user flow, complete vertical slice |
219
+ | **5. Supporting** | Stark + Galadriel | Remaining features in dependency order, small batches |
220
+ | **6. Integrations** | Stark | Payments, email, storage, external APIs |
221
+ | **7. Admin** | Stark + Galadriel | Dashboard, user management, audit logging |
222
+ | **8. Marketing** | Galadriel | Landing pages, pricing, legal, SEO |
223
+ | **9. QA Pass** | Batman | Full test suite, bug hunting, regression checklist |
224
+ | **10. UX/UI Pass** | Galadriel | Accessibility audit, responsive design, state coverage |
225
+ | **11. Security Pass** | Kenobi | OWASP audit, secrets scan, dependency check |
226
+ | **12. Deploy** | Kusanagi | Production provisioning, monitoring, backups |
227
+ | **13. Launch** | All | Final checklist — SSL, email, payments, analytics, monitoring |
228
+
229
+ ### PRD Frontmatter
230
+
231
+ Your PRD starts with a YAML block that controls which phases run:
232
+
233
+ ```yaml
234
+ ---
235
+ type: full-stack # full-stack | api-only | static-site | prototype
236
+ auth: yes # yes | no
237
+ payments: stripe # stripe | lemonsqueezy | none
238
+ workers: no # yes | no
239
+ admin: yes # yes | no
240
+ marketing: no # yes | no
241
+ email: resend # resend | sendgrid | ses | none
242
+ deploy: vps # vps | vercel | railway | cloudflare | static | docker
243
+ ---
244
+ ```
245
+
246
+ Set `auth: no`? Phase 3 is skipped. Set `marketing: no`? Phase 8 is skipped. Set `type: api-only`? Phases 8 and 10 are skipped. The protocol adapts to your project.
247
+
248
+ ### Verification Gates
249
+
250
+ Every phase has a gate — a combination of manual verification and automated checks:
251
+
252
+ - **Phase 0:** All PRD sections accounted for, frontmatter validates
253
+ - **Phase 1:** `npm run build` passes, test runner works
254
+ - **Phase 2:** Dev server starts, database connects, `npm test` passes
255
+ - **Phase 3:** Login/signup/logout works, auth tests pass
256
+ - **Phase 4:** Core journey works end-to-end, >80% service coverage
257
+ - **Phase 5:** Each batch works, no regressions, all tests pass
258
+ - **Phase 9:** All critical/high bugs fixed, full test suite green
259
+ - **Phase 11:** No critical/high security findings
260
+ - **Phase 12:** App loads in production, health check passes, monitoring receives data
261
+ - **Phase 13:** All checklist items verified
262
+
263
+ **Gates are breaking.** Failing tests prevent phase advancement. No exceptions.
264
+
265
+ ### Small Batches
266
+
267
+ During feature phases (4-8), work happens in small batches:
268
+ - One user flow or component cluster per batch
269
+ - Max ~200 lines of production code (tests don't count)
270
+ - Each batch is independently verifiable
271
+ - If a batch breaks something, revert it, isolate the issue, fix, and re-apply
272
+
273
+ ### Session Recovery
274
+
275
+ Long builds span multiple Claude Code sessions. The build journal system handles this:
276
+ 1. Every phase logs to `/logs/phase-XX-*.md`
277
+ 2. Master state lives in `/logs/build-state.md` (read at every session start)
278
+ 3. Decisions go to `/logs/decisions.md`, handoffs to `/logs/handoffs.md`
279
+ 4. New sessions pick up from the journal, not from scratch
280

468
+ #### `/thumper` — Chani's Worm Rider
469
+ **When:** You want to control Claude Code from your phone via Telegram.
470
+
471
+ *"Tell me of your homeworld, Usul."*
472
+
473
+ Plant a thumper in the sand and ride the worm. Chani opens a bidirectional Telegram bridge to your running Claude Code session. Send prompts from anywhere — a coffee shop, your phone, another machine. Claude's responses are sent back automatically via the Water Rings (stop hook).
474
+
475
+ The Gom Jabbar protocol gates everything. On first activation, you choose a passphrase ("word of passage"). It's hashed with PBKDF2 and erased from your Telegram chat. After 60 minutes of idle, the Reverend Mother demands the test again — prove you're human. Three wrong attempts and The Voice is silenced for 5 minutes.
476
+
477
+ The sandworm daemon auto-detects your environment: tmux (preferred, cross-platform), PTY injection (headless Linux), or osascript (macOS Terminal.app/iTerm2). For VS Code, Warp, Alacritty, or Kitty users on macOS, tmux is recommended.
478
+
479
+ Setup: `/thumper setup` (one-time). Control: `/thumper on` / `/thumper off` / `/thumper status`.

+ ## 6. The Craft
623
+
624
+ ### Code Patterns
625
+
626
+ Thirty-five reference implementations live in `docs/patterns/`. Every pattern includes framework adaptations for Next.js, Express, Django, FastAPI, and Rails. Mobile and game patterns added in v9.2-v9.3. Financial, daemon, SSE, ad platform, and OAuth patterns added in v11-v15.
627
+
628
+ | Pattern | File | What It Teaches |
629
+ |---------|------|----------------|
630
+ | **API Route** | `api-route.ts` | Zod validation, auth check, service call, consistent response (+ DRF, FastAPI) |
631
+ | **Service** | `service.ts` | Business logic in services, ownership checks, typed errors (+ Django, FastAPI) |
632
+ | **Component** | `component.tsx` | All 4 states (loading, empty, error, success), keyboard accessible (+ HTMX) |
633
+ | **Middleware** | `middleware.ts` | Auth middleware, request logging, rate limiting (+ Django, FastAPI) |
634
+ | **Error Handling** | `error-handling.ts` | Canonical error strategy (+ DRF exception handler, FastAPI) |
635
+ | **Job Queue** | `job-queue.ts` | Background jobs: idempotency, retry, dead letter queue (+ Celery, ARQ) |
636
+ | **Multi-Tenant** | `multi-tenant.ts` | Workspace scoping, tenant isolation, RBAC (+ django-tenants) |
637
+ | **Third-Party Script** | `third-party-script.ts` | External script loading with 3 states |
638
+ | **Mobile Screen** | `mobile-screen.tsx` | React Native screen with safe area, a11y, 4 states |
639
+ | **Mobile Service** | `mobile-service.ts` | Offline-first data with sync queue, conflict resolution |
640
+ | **Game Loop** | `game-loop.ts` | Fixed timestep with interpolation, pause/resume, frame budget |
641
+ | **Game State** | `game-state.ts` | Hierarchical state machine with history, save/load |
642
+ | **Game Entity** | `game-entity.ts` | Entity Component System with component stores and systems |
643
+ | **SSE Endpoint** | `sse-endpoint.ts` | Server-Sent Events: lifecycle, keepalive, timeout, React hook (+ FastAPI, Django) |
644
+ | **Ad Platform Adapter** | `ad-platform-adapter.ts` | Split interface: setup (interactive) + adapter (runtime) + read-only (daemon) |
645
+ | **Financial Transaction** | `financial-transaction.ts` | Branded Cents type, hash-chained append log, atomic writes, number formatting |
646
+ | **Daemon Process** | `daemon-process.ts` | PID management, Unix socket API, job scheduler, signal handling, sleep/wake recovery |
647
+ | **Revenue Source Adapter** | `revenue-source-adapter.ts` | Read-only revenue interface with Stripe + Paddle reference implementations |
648
+ | **OAuth Token Lifecycle** | `oauth-token-lifecycle.ts` | Refresh at 80% TTL, failure escalation, vault integration, session token rotation |
649
+ | **Outbound Rate Limiter** | `outbound-rate-limiter.ts` | Token bucket with backpressure, per-provider limits, retry-after handling |
650
+ | **AI Orchestrator** | `ai-orchestrator.ts` | Agent loop, tool use, retry, circuit breaker, fallback |
651
+ | **AI Classifier** | `ai-classifier.ts` | Classification with confidence thresholds, human fallback |
652
+ | **AI Router** | `ai-router.ts` | Intent-based routing with fallback chains |
653
+ | **Prompt Template** | `prompt-template.ts` | Versioned prompts with variable injection, testing |
654
+ | **AI Eval** | `ai-eval.ts` | Golden datasets, scoring, regression detection |
655
+ | **AI Tool Schema** | `ai-tool-schema.ts` | Type-safe tool definitions with provider adapters |
656
+ | **Database Migration** | `database-migration.ts` | Safe migrations: backward-compat, batched ops, rollback, zero-downtime validation |
657
+ | **Data Pipeline** | `data-pipeline.ts` | ETL pipeline: typed stages, checkpoint/resume, quality checks, idempotent processing |
658
+ | **Backtest Engine** | `backtest-engine.ts` | Walk-forward backtesting: no-lookahead, slippage, Sharpe/drawdown/profit factor |
659
+ | **Execution Safety** | `execution-safety.ts` | Trading execution: order validation, position limits, exchange precision, paper/live toggle |
660
+ | **E2E Test** | `e2e-test.ts` | Page Object Model, axe-core fixture, auth helper, network mock, CWV measurement |
661
+ | **Browser Review** | `browser-review.ts` | Console capture, behavioral walkthrough, security inspection, screenshot evidence |
662
+ | **Stablecoin Adapter** | `stablecoin-adapter.ts` | Off-ramp lifecycle, balance reads, transfer tracking, Circle reference |
663
+ | **Ad Billing Adapter** | `ad-billing-adapter.ts` | Billing capability classification, invoice reads, settlement instructions |
664
+ | **Funding Plan** | `funding-plan.ts` | Branded Cents, FundingPlan FSM, runway calculation, reconciliation matching |
665
+
666
+ ### Coding Standards
667
+
668
+ These are enforced across every phase:
669
+
670
+ - **TypeScript strict mode.** No `any` unless unavoidable and commented.
671
+ - **Small files.** One component per file. Max ~300 lines.
672
+ - **Validate at boundaries.** Zod schemas on all API inputs.
673
+ - **Error handling.** Use `ApiError` types per the error-handling pattern. Never leak internals.
674
+ - **Logging.** Structured JSON with requestId, userId, action. Never log PII.
675
+ - **Business logic in services, not routes.** Routes: validate, call service, format response.
676
+ - **Ownership checks on every query.** No IDOR. Return 404, not 403.
677
+ - **Accessibility is not optional.** Keyboard nav, focus management, contrast, ARIA.
678
+ - **Small batches.** Max ~200 lines changed, one flow per batch, verify after each.
679
+ - **No stubs.** Never ship placeholder code. If it's not ready, don't create the file.
680
+ - **Screenshot every page during review.** Agents must visually inspect running applications.
681
+
682
+ ### Testing Philosophy
683
+
684
+ Tests are written alongside features, not bolted on after. They're a **breaking gate** — failing tests prevent phase advancement.
685
+
686
+ - **Unit tests** for business logic (vitest/jest/pytest/RSpec)
687
+ - **Integration tests** for API routes
688
+ - **Regression checklist** grows with every feature (2-3 items per feature, 30-50 by launch)
689
+ - **Framework mapping** in `docs/methods/TESTING.md`

+ ## 7. The Archive
694
+
695
+ ### Operational Learnings
696
+
697
+ Multi-session projects accumulate operational knowledge — API quirks, decision rationale, root causes, environment constraints. VoidForge stores these in `docs/LEARNINGS.md`, a curated file that persists across sessions.
698
+
699
+ **How it works:**
700
+ - `/debrief` proposes candidate learnings after a session → you approve or reject each one
701
+ - `/vault` catches any remaining learnings at session end
702
+ - `/build`, `/campaign`, `/architect`, and `/assemble` read the file at startup — your next session starts with the operational context from all previous sessions
703
+
704
+ **What goes in:** Verified operational facts discovered by live testing that code review can't catch. Decision rationale ("we chose X over Y because Z"). External system behaviors specific to this project. Root causes that took multiple attempts to identify.
705
+
706
+ **What stays out:** Code patterns (→ `docs/LESSONS.md`), methodology gaps (→ field reports), config values (→ `.env`), opinions.
707
+
708
+ **Maintenance:** 50-entry hard cap. Entries older than 90 days without re-verification are flagged as stale. Learnings that appear in 2+ projects get promoted to `LESSONS.md` via Wong's pipeline — a pointer replaces the original entry.
709
+
710
+ The file is created automatically when you approve your first learning. Projects that don't need it get zero overhead.
711
+
712
+ ### Build Journal
713
+
714
+ The build journal is VoidForge's persistent memory. When context compresses or a new session starts, agents read journal files to recover state.
715
+
716
+ **Files:**
717
+ - `logs/build-state.md` — Master state file, read at every session start (under 50 lines)
718
+ - `logs/phase-XX-*.md` — Per-phase logs with decisions, test results, findings
719
+ - `logs/decisions.md` — Running log of all non-obvious decisions
720
+ - `logs/handoffs.md` — Every agent-to-agent handoff with context
721
+ - `logs/errors.md` — What broke, why, how it was fixed
722
+
723
+ **Protocol:**
724
+ 1. **Start of session:** Read `build-state.md` to recover state
725
+ 2. **During work:** Log decisions, test results, and findings to the active phase log
726
+ 3. **End of session:** Update `build-state.md` with current state
727
+
728
+ ### Context Management
729
+
730
+ Claude Code has a finite context window. VoidForge keeps sessions fast:
731
+
732
+ - Load method docs **on demand**, not all at once. Read frontend docs when doing frontend work.
733
+ - **One phase or agent domain per session.** Don't try to do everything in one sitting.
734
+ - If **50+ files read** or **100+ tool calls**, checkpoint to `build-state.md` and suggest a new session.
735
+ - New sessions pick up from the journal, not from scratch.

+ ## 8. Troubleshooting
750
+
751
+ ### Phase Gate Failures
752
+
753
+ **Gate fails = you stop.** Don't push through. Don't stack changes on top of broken code.
754
+
755
+ 1. Log the failure in the phase log and `logs/errors.md`
756
+ 2. Identify the breaking change (check recent diffs)
757
+ 3. Revert the change: `git revert <commit>` or `git stash`
758
+ 4. Verify the regression is gone
759
+ 5. Fix the specific issue
760
+ 6. Re-apply with the fix included
761
+ 7. Re-verify the gate
762
+
763
+ ### Context Window Filling Up
764
+
765
+ Signs: Claude starts forgetting earlier decisions, responses slow down, tool calls increase.
766
+
767
+ 1. Update `logs/build-state.md` with your current state
768
+ 2. Start a new Claude Code session
769
+ 3. The new session reads the journal and continues
770
+
771
+ ### Build Journal Corruption
772
+
773
+ If `build-state.md` gets corrupted or out of date:
774
+
775
+ 1. Check `git log` for recent commits — they tell you what phase you're in
776
+ 2. Read the most recent `logs/phase-XX-*.md` files
777
+ 3. Reconstruct `build-state.md` from these sources
778
+ 4. Continue
779
+
780
+ ### PRD Gaps
781
+
782
+ If Phase 0 flags critical gaps (no schema, no stack, no features):
783
+
784
+ 1. **Stop.** Don't proceed with assumptions.
785
+ 2. Fill the gaps in `docs/PRD.md`
786
+ 3. Re-run `/build` — Phase 0 will re-validate
787
+
788
+ ### Deploy Failures
789
+
790
+ If Phase 12 or a deploy script fails:
791
+
792
+ 1. The deploy script auto-rolls back on health check failure (VPS)
793
+ 2. Check logs: SSH into the server, check PM2 logs or Caddy logs
794
+ 3. For platform deploys (Vercel/Railway), check the platform dashboard
795
+ 4. Fix locally, commit, re-deploy
796
+
797
+ ### Common Issues
798
+
799
+ | Problem | Fix |
800
+ |---------|-----|
801
+ | `npm run build` fails after scaffold | Check TypeScript errors — usually a missing type or import |
802
+ | Auth tests fail | Check session config, cookie settings, CSRF token setup |
803
+ | Database won't connect | Verify `.env` has correct DB_URL, check if DB is running |
804
+ | Deploy script hangs | Check SSH connectivity, verify key permissions (0600) |
805
+ | Test runner not found | Phase 1 should set it up — re-run scaffold if missing |
806
+ | Context fills mid-phase | Checkpoint to journal, new session, continue |
807
+ | npm install fails on Windows | node-pty needs C++ tools. Use `--ignore-scripts` or `npx voidforge-build init --headless` |
